The LG G3 has a general score of 76.4, which is way better than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7's overall score of 52.2. Both phones we are comparing here come with Android OS, but the LG G3 has the newer 5.0 version while Alcatel OneTouch POP C7 has Android 4.2. LG G3 is a thinner and just a little bit lighter phone than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7.
LG G3 counts with a much better looking display than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7, because it has a lot higher number of pixels per inch of screen, a little larger screen and a way better resolution of 2560 x 1440 pixels. LG G3 counts with a much better memory for applications and games than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7, because it has a SD memory slot that supports up to 128 GB and more internal memory capacity.
LG G3 has a better processor than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7, and although they both have 4 cores, the LG G3 also has more RAM and an extra graphics co-processor. LG G3 features a lot better camera than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7, because it has a much more MP back-facing camera and a lot higher 3840x2160 video resolution.
LG G3 features a superior battery lifetime than Alcatel OneTouch POP C7, because it has 3000mAh of battery capacity instead of 2000mAh.
The LG G3 and the Alcatel OneTouch POP C7 cost the same.
